I can connect to the remote server with putty,
I would like to ask that, in UNIX command, any command can return me the operating system version that currently in use by the remote server ?

let say in DOS
c:\cmd
Microsoft(R) Windows DOS
(C)Copyright Microsoft Corp 1990-2001.

any similar command in UNIX ???
